Salaries In The UK: What To Expect And How To Navigate Compensation

Understanding salary expectations is crucial for anyone considering working in the UK. The UK employment salary landscape is influenced by various factors, including location, industry, experience, and the broader economic climate.Average Salary Overview: As of 2023, the average annual salary for an employee in the UK was around £34,963.
